An Incredibly Chic Paris Apartment

Designed by Isabelle Stanislas

Décor Inspiration: An Incredibly Chic Paris Apartment Designed by Isabelle Stanislas
All Photography by Matthieu Salvaing

THERE AREN’T many Paris apartments that we don’t like, but when we come across ones that are Joseph Dirand-esque, like this incredibly chic bachelor pad in the Place du Trocadéro, it’s a very special thing. Designed by Paris-based interior designer Isabelle Stanislas, the 4,800-square-foot pied-à-terre is the ultimate in sophistication with its muted tones, chevron wood flooring and boiserie. It is a study in art and architecture—Salinas opened the living room to the dome above and added a sweeping staircase—as well as restraint and an astonishing amount of wood.
